About Jorge

Hello, I am a graduate in Spanish Philology and Audiovisual Communication, with Masters in Teacher Training Secondary Education, specializing in Language and Literature, Master in Advanced Studies in Philosophy and a Masters in Creative Writing. I'm a writer and poet, master grammar and literature, and now my Ph.D. course. I volunteer as a tutor in Spanish Language and Literature at all levels. My methodology is fun teaching, by showing the student how wonderful language and all its components. I have always intended to take my students to the field he likes, to be passionate and see it as a game where the wisdom is reaching generates so much hope, so much hope, so much love. Patience is my greatest virtue, and there is no challenge that someone is enraged with the Spanish Language and Literature to build on it a different perception that allows you view it from another interesting angle. My motto is "Education can change if generated an illusion" and that is my emphasis. I am at the disposal of the student, my classes start from concept to deep, giving examples from everyday life to entertain teach and to show the listener that nothing is more wonderful than our language, the second largest in the world, for me, the first. In addition, I also offer as a Spanish teacher for foreigners. To perfect their oral and written, with the supreme rigor.

  • ¿Cuánto tiempo hace que estás interesado en las lenguas y en particular en la enseñanza del español?

    Hace ya 6 años. Todo empezó cuando viajé a Inglaterra y enseñaba español a amigos, profesionales de finanzas y universitarios.
  • ¿Que escritor hispanófono ha conseguido que no levantes la vista de su libro durante horas? ¿Que libro en concreto?

    "Falcó" de Arturo Pérez Reverte.
  • ¿Que canción en español no te cansas de escuchar una y otra vez? ¿Por qué?

    "Duermes" de Ismael Serrano. Es pura poesía. Las palabras salen del alma y no del cerebro.
  • ¿Cómo transmites la cultura española en tus clases?

    A través de la literatura y de la historia.
  • Llegó el momento de abrir el cajón de los secretos... Dinos, ¿alguna vez te has peleado con las decisiones de la RAE?

    Muchas veces. Sobre todo, por no incluir determinadas palabras con el pretexto de que no están en el dominio social.
  • ¿Cual es la expresión en español que más te gusta? ¿Y la que más usas?

    "Cada persona es dueña de su silencio y esclava de sus palabras", es la que más uso.
    La que más me gusta es: "El hambre aguza el ingenio".
  • Cuéntanos alguna anécdota que te ha sucedido trabajando o durante tus estudios (que no comience por "un día en una fiesta…", si es posible ;)

    Tenía un alumno que odiaba la lectura, pero amaba el cine, así que le di un guion de una película, trabajamos sobre él, y empezó a amar las letras.
    En otra ocasión, haciendo un dictado con un alumno dijo "¡putos acentos!". Le dije que yo no había inventado las reglas y solo era un obrero de las palabras: nos reímos mucho.
  • En tu opinión, ¿cuáles son las cualidades que debe tener un Superprof de Español?

    • Divertir enseñando conceptos.
    • Lograr descubrir lo que más ama el alumno/la alumna, que quizás ni siquiera sepa, y profundizar en ello lo máximo posible.
    • Subsanar las deficiencias de un sistema educativo que no atiende a las necesidades específicas de cada persona, que es, intrínsecamente, única.
